West Ham and Prem rivals set to battle for Wolfsburg star Maxence Lacroix this summer

Both West Ham and Aston Villa are rumoured to battle for Wolfsburg defender Maxence Lacroix in the upcoming transfer window.

Lacroix has cemented himself in the heart of Wolfsburg’s defence this season following his impressive performances. The 22-year-old has been one of the best players among the team and is consistently solid.

This form, however, has attracted interest from two Premier League teams, according to a report from Jeunes Footeux.

The report states that both West Ham and Villa are ‘interested’ in Lacroix and each are ‘attentive’ to his situation.

This is as far as the story delves into the pair’s interest. Lacroix has three years left on his Wolfsburg deal which means he could be priced high.

The report does, however, claim that if Wolfsburg get a suitable offer, they would consider his sale.

West Ham are seemingly battling Villa for his transfer as their top priority remains to add depth to their squad.

The Villans are also after a centre-back to improve their chances of retaining their Premier League status.

As well as this, there have been rumours of Steven Gerrard orchestrating a defensive overhaul before the upcoming season.

While Lacroix has had links with Villa, so too has Liverpool’s Joe Gomez.

Throughout the majority of the season, Lacroix has been deployed in centre-back in a 4-2-3-1 formation.

This links in well with David Moyes’ vision as West Ham commonly lineup the same way. The 22-year-old has also been used as the right-sided centre-back.

This would allow him to back up the aging Craig Dawson. Angelo Ogbonna and Issa Diop are the usual deputies for either side. However, the pair have missed large portions of this season.
